Output 048e718d7d67802575e802b1a7a0aa0c022a16d5098330046dbcf36c82f22329:1

value
17106037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ab513f08a1985fb1763badd3b4e74f383b8d1a93 OP_EQUAL
address
3HJroS6Rt2WUQ3TH3zd8rBSqXkoz2o1zoC
transaction
048e718d7d67802575e802b1a7a0aa0c022a16d5098330046dbcf36c82f22329
confirmations
284230
spent
true